Novogradac & Company LLP is seeking a Tax Manager to join our fast-growing firm. The candidate will manage tax assignments under the direction of the Principal or Partner, work autonomously, and focus on supervising and mentoring Staff and Senior Accountants, independent problem‑solving, strengthening client relationships, and increasing office profitability. Remote or hybrid arrangements may be available depending on business needs.

Responsibilities

Assume primary responsibility for client engagements, including planning, staffing, timing, technical issues, and other decisions. Oversee engagement completion, identifying and solving problem areas during the engagement with minimal oversight or assistance.

Conduct thorough engagement reviews.

Supervise and mentor Supervisors, Senior Accountants, and Staff, guiding and educating them in technical areas, identifying professional development opportunities, and maintaining a respectful team atmosphere.

Complete annual performance evaluations for assigned staff and manage employee performance conversations.

Assist Principals and Partners in identifying, meeting with, and pursuing new clients.

Turn acquired technical knowledge into high‑value‑added opportunities for clients.

Promote the Firm’s image by participating on conference panels, contributing to firm publications, attending recruiting events, conducting in‑house and client trainings, etc.

Demonstrate an understanding of the value of enhancing the Novogradac brand by fostering collegial relationships with all Partners, employees, clients, and prospects.

Develop, strengthen, and grow client relationships through professionalism, responsiveness, and a service‑oriented approach.

Enhance skills in the industries the Firm focuses on by seeking out and completing training courses.

Increase office profitability by managing your time and the time of Staff and Senior Accountants efficiently, contributing ideas and adding value.

Other duties and projects as assigned.

Qualifications & Skills

Bachelor’s degree, preferably in accounting or finance (advanced degree is a plus).

3‑7+ years of experience in public accounting and/or an appropriate balance of education and work experience.

CPA license required.

Expert understanding of accounting and tax rules.

Excellent verbal and written communication skills.

Intellectual curiosity and strong personal, technical, and professional judgment.

Accurate, timely work with strong attention to detail.

Strong organizational and follow‑through skills.

Ability to prioritize a fast‑paced, varied workload and manage concurrent priorities.

Open to constructive feedback from the Partner group and able to adjust accordingly.

Collaborative and can foster a productive, team‑oriented environment.

Strong computer skills in Microsoft Office (especially Excel) and report‑writing tools.

Professional demeanor with coworkers and clients.

Gaining the confidence of the existing Partner group.

Meet internal firm deadlines (time entry, billing, etc.).

Available to work evenings and weekends as required and travel domestically if needed.

Experience with Affordable Housing, Low Income Housing Tax Credits (LIHTC), Opportunity Zones (OZ), Renewable Energy Tax Credits (RETC), Historical Tax Credits (HTC), HUD, New Markets Tax Credits (NMTC), real estate, developers, partnerships, housing authorities, nonprofit, single audit, A‑133, cost segregation, Year 15 exit, tax‑exempt bonds and HOME programs is helpful but not mandatory.
